Dream scenario
The Inner Voice Against the Mold
You are surrounded by a group engaged in a highly ordered, ritualistic activity—a meeting, a class, a march—but you feel a powerful, quiet refusal within you. You are not actively protesting, but your refusal to conform is palpable, like a low hum beneath the surface noise.
Symbolic reading
This is the emergence of your authentic self pushing back against internalized dogma or groupthink. The 'anarchist' element is your refusal to accept a prescribed identity or role simply because it is tradition or expectation.
Practical reading
You are likely in a phase of self-discovery where you are questioning the unspoken rules of your social group, family, or career path. The dream encourages you to trust that quiet, intuitive pushback.
Psychology explanation
This scenario speaks to the integration of the shadow self—the parts of you that society or your past self deemed unacceptable. The inner rebel is demanding agency and the right to define your own terms of existence.
